Key Responsibilities for Team Labourer & Groundworker Roles

Groundworker positions in Shoreditch involve a diverse range of tasks essential to laying the foundations for successful construction projects. You'll be working as part of a coordinated team on various aspects of site preparation and groundwork operations.

Excavation & Earth Moving

Operating alongside machine operators to prepare trenches, foundation areas, and drainage runs. Manual excavation work in restricted areas where machinery cannot access. Backfilling and compacting excavated areas to specification.

Drainage & Utilities Installation

Laying drainage pipes, installing manholes, and connecting utility services. Working to precise levels and gradients as specified by site engineers. Ensuring proper bedding and surround materials are used according to specifications.

Concrete Work & Foundations

Assisting with formwork installation and concrete pours for foundations, floor slabs, and structural elements. Finishing concrete surfaces, installing reinforcement, and ensuring proper curing procedures are followed.

General Site Support

Material handling and distribution across the site. Maintaining clean and organized work areas. Supporting other trades as required. Adhering to strict health and safety protocols at all times.

Safety-Critical Requirements

All groundworker positions in Shoreditch require strict adherence to HSE construction safety regulations. You'll be working on sites with active plant machinery, at various depths, and potentially near existing services, making safety awareness absolutely paramount.

3. What's the difference between PAYE and CIS payment, and which should I choose?

We offer both PAYE (Pay As You Earn) and CIS (Construction Industry Scheme) payment options because different workers have different circumstances. With PAYE, you're employed directly by our agency, and we handle all tax and National Insurance deductions automatically – your payslip shows exactly what you've earned and what's been deducted, making tax time straightforward. This option suits workers who prefer simplicity and don't want to worry about annual tax returns. With CIS, you're working as a subcontractor, and we deduct tax at either 20% (if you're CIS registered) or 30% (if not registered) and pay the remainder to you. You'll need to complete a self-assessment tax return annually, but many workers prefer CIS because it can offer certain tax advantages, particularly if you have legitimate business expenses you can claim. Both options result in weekly payment every Friday, and both are completely legitimate. If you're unsure which suits your situation better, we're happy to explain the implications of each during your initial consultation. You can also consult with an accountant for personalized advice – many construction workers work with specialized accountants who understand the industry.
